Who were the victims in the Murdaugh murders real story?

Maggie Murdaugh and her son Paul Murdaugh were the victims. Maggie was the wife of Alex Murdaugh, and Paul was their son. Their murders led to a long and complex investigation that uncovered a lot about the Murdaugh family and Alex's wrongdoings.

Who were the victims in the Essex Boys Murders Story?

The Essex Boys Murders had three victims. They were Tony Tucker, who was involved in the local drug scene. Pat Tate was also a part of that world, and Craig Rolfe. All three were found dead together in a Range Rover, which was a significant and shocking discovery in this case.
